Bunkering Operations definition
Bunkering Operations means the transfer of Bunkers between vessels, road tankers, by approved fuel containers or shore facilities.
Bunkering Operations means the transfer of Bunkers from Bunker Barges, road tankers or shore facilities to a Ship, the transfer of Bunkers from a Ship to road tankers or shore facilities, and the transfer of Ship-generated Waste from a Ship to Bunker Barges, road tankers or shore facilities;
Bunkering Operations means the transfer of Bunkers between vessels, road tankers or shore facilities;
